Iron Man #20

One of the Mandarin rings seeks out a new host, and Banner/Hulk are one of the potential hosts it evaluates. Hulk is referred to as a "galactically known planetary threat."

That is not a strength feat, per se. The energy-source from which Hulk derives his strength is being harnessed and repurposed(via retardedly haxxed tech) to shield the earth from Exitar's foot. Hulk himself is not physically holding Exitar's foot at bay--he is simply the medium through which said energies are being channeled.

...But in terms of raw energy output/potential, that is very impressive.
